GatekeeperGatekeeper is recommended for businesses of various sizes, particularly those that manage a significant number of contracts and vendor relationships. It is ideal for procurement teams, legal departments, and any organization looking to streamline their contract management, improve compliance, and gain better visibility into their vendor performance.

Nix currently is akin to git's "porcelain": powerful but esoteric. However, much like git evolved into exoteric, user-friendly tools such as git-flow, GitHub Desktop, and Tower to become user-friendly, many developers are building abstractions, wrappers, and utilities to simplify Nix usage.
